NOTE: Please enter the course name and any particular questions you have for the tutor in the comments section. Asking particular questions helps the tutor focus on what you want.
- Examples of good questions:
- "I think my thesis is too broad. Do you have any suggestions for making it more specific?"
- "I have a hard time integrating quotations. Can you focus on quotations?"
- "Paragraph 4 is a mess. I'm not sure how to connect my supporting ideas to my thesis. Do you have any suggestions?
